آموزش یادگیری لینوکس CentOS

Learning CentOS Linux

نکته: آخرین آپدیت رو دریافت میکنید حتی اگر این محتوا بروز نباشد.
نمونه ویدیوها:
توضیحات دوره: CentOS یک توزیع لینوکس (مشتق شده از Red Hat Enterprise Linux) است که بین مدیران سیستم ، مهندسان DevOps و کاربران خانگی محبوب است. همچنین توسط بسیاری از سازمان ها برای سرورهای توسعه و تولید استفاده می شود. در این دوره ، یاد بگیرید که چگونه CentOS را نصب و راه بیندازید ، کارهای مشترک را از خط فرمان انجام دهید ، و یک فایروال ، یک وب سرور و پوشه های مشترک را راه اندازی کنید. مربی اسکات سیمپسون همچنین نکات مربوط به عیب یابی را به اشتراک می گذارد و در مورد لینوکس تقویت شده با امنیت (SELinux) بحث می کند ، که سطح امنیتی بیشتری را به CentOS اضافه می کند.
موضوعات شامل:
  • CentOS چیست؟
  • نصب CentOS
  • پیکربندی شبکه به صورت دستی
  • پیکربندی شبکه با NetworkManager
  • اتصال از راه دور
  • کار با لینوکس (SELinux) تقویت شده امنیتی
  • نصب فایروال
  • راه اندازی سرور وب
  • اشتراک پوشه های خانه کاربر با سامبا
  • تنظیم محیط دسکتاپ
  • عیب یابی

سرفصل ها و درس ها

مقدمه Introduction

  • یادگیری CentOS Learning CentOS

  • CentOS چیست؟ What is CentOS?

  • آنچه باید بدانید What you should know

1. شروع کار 1. Getting Started

  • گزینه های نصب Installation options

  • نصب CentOS در یک ماشین مجازی Installing CentOS on a virtual machine

  • ایجاد رسانه نصب Creating installation media

  • نصب CentOS در دستگاه فیزیکی Installing CentOS on a physical machine

2. مدیریت اساسی 2. Basic Administration

  • سیستم فایل لینوکس و Filesystem Hierarchy Standard The Linux file system and the Filesystem Hierarchy Standard

  • پیکربندی شبکه برای سرور CentOS Configuring the network for a CentOS server

  • پیکربندی شبکه به صورت دستی Configuring the network manually

  • پیکربندی شبکه با NetworkManager Configuring the network with NetworkManager

  • تنظیم نام میزبان Setting the hostname

  • اتصال به سیستم از راه دور با Secure Shell (SSH) Connecting to the system remotely with Secure Shell (SSH)

  • اضافه کردن یک کاربر اداری با دسترسی SSH Adding an administrative user with SSH access

  • برای دسترسی به SSH یک کلید به کاربر اضافه کنید Adding a key to a user for SSH access

  • انتقال پرونده ها به و از سرور Transferring files to and from the server

  • مجوزهای پرونده File permissions

  • کار با کاربران و گروه ها Working with users and groups

  • نصب و بروزرسانی نرم افزار Installing and updating software

  • نصب بسته ها به صورت گروهی Installing packages by group

  • نصب بسته ها از منابع دیگر Installing packages from other sources

3. کار با لینوکس پیشرفته امنیتی (SELinux) 3. Working with Security-Enhanced Linux (SELinux)

  • معرفی SELinux Introducing SELinux

  • مکانیسم ها و سیاست های کنترل دسترسی Access control mechanisms and policies

  • همکاری با SELinux Working with SELinux

  • غیرفعال کردن SELinux Disabling SELinux

4- کار با خدمات و برنامه های مشترک 4. Working with Common Services and Applications

  • مدیریت خدمات Service management

  • تنظیم فایروال با استفاده از firewalld Setting up the firewall using firewalld

  • تنظیم سرور وب Setting up a web server

  • اشتراک پوشه های خانگی کاربر با سامبا Sharing user home folders with Samba

  • ایجاد اشتراک گذاری پرونده گروهی با سامبا Creating a group file share with Samba

  • نصب سهم سامبا در CentOS Mounting a Samba share on CentOS

5. با استفاده از یک دسک تاپ 5. Using a Desktop

  • تنظیم یک محیط دسک تاپ Setting up a desktop environment

  • کاوش در محیط دسک تاپ Exploring the desktop environment

  • دسترسی به اشتراک گذاری صفحه با VNC مجاز است Allowing screen-sharing access with VNC

6. عیب یابی 6. Troubleshooting

  • فرآیند راه اندازی The startup process

  • کاوش سیاههها Exploring the logs

  • بررسی و مدیریت منابع سیستم Checking and managing system resources

نتیجه Conclusion

  • مراحل بعدی Next Steps

نمایش نظرات

آموزش یادگیری لینوکس CentOS
جزییات دوره
2h 11m
38
Linkedin (لینکدین) Linkedin (لینکدین)
(آخرین آپدیت)
33,377
- از 5
ندارد
دارد
دارد
Scott Simpson
جهت دریافت آخرین اخبار و آپدیت ها در کانال تلگرام عضو شوید.

Google Chrome Browser

Internet Download Manager

Pot Player

Winrar

Scott Simpson Scott Simpson

ایجاد دوره های فناوری به عنوان نویسنده ارشد در لینکدین

اسکات سیمپسون دوره های فناوری را به عنوان نویسنده ارشد در لینکدین ایجاد می کند.

اسکات از زمانی که به کامپیوتر علاقه مند بوده است حدوداً هفت ساله بود و در بیشتر این مدت، به دوستان، خانواده و غریبه ها یاد می داد که چگونه از آنها استفاده کنند. این سرگرمی عجیب و غریب در دوران کالج به شغلی با اپل تبدیل شد. اسکات پس از گذراندن دوره کارشناسی ارشد خود در تحصیل در دانشگاه ایالتی سن دیگو، به شکل گیری دوره های فناوری و توسعه دهنده در lynda.com به عنوان یک تولید کننده محتوا کمک کرد. اسکات به عنوان یک نویسنده ارشد آموزش لینکدین، بر آموزش لینوکس، SQL، امنیت و سایر موضوعات فناوری به طیف گسترده ای از زبان آموزان در سراسر جهان تمرکز دارد. وقتی اسکات دوره های فناوری نمی سازد، از سفر، مطالعه و عکاسی لذت می برد.